Parameter Reference

This is a comprehensive list of parameters for the Insights API:

  • Filters: Specify what kind of results you want. These parameters narrow the results to a specific entity type (like movies, places, or artists), tags, or location.
  • Signals: Specify what to base the recommendations on. These parameters influence the ranking by providing context, such as audience demographics, user interests, or related entities.
  • Output: Specify how the results are presented. These parameters control aspects like the number of results displayed (take) and which page of results to show (page).

filter.location

string

Filter by a WKT POINT, POLYGON, MULTIPOLYGON or a single Qloo ID for a named urn:entity:locality.

WKT is formatted as X then Y, therefore longitude is first (POINT(-73.99823 40.722668)).

If a Qloo ID or WKT POLYGON is passed, filter.location.radius will create a <glossary:fuzzy> boundary when set to a value > 0.

Destination, Place

filter.exclude.location

string

Exclude results that fall within a specific location, defined by either a WKT POINT, POLYGON, MULTIPOLYGON, or a Qloo ID for a named urn:entity:locality.
WKT is formatted with longitude first (e.g., POINT(-73.99823 40.722668)).
When using a locality ID or a WKT POLYGON, setting filter.location.radius to a value > 0 creates a fuzzy exclusion boundary.

Destination, Place

filter.location.query

string

A query used to search for one or more named urn:entity:locality Qloo IDs for filtering requests, equivalent to passing the same Locality Qloo ID(s) into filter.location.

  • For GET requests: Provide a single locality query as a string.
  • For POST requests:
    • You can still send a single locality as a string.
    • Or you can send an array of locality names to query multiple localities at once. When multiple localities are provided, their geographic shapes are merged, and the system returns results with the highest affinities across the combined area.Locality queries are fuzzy-matched and case-insensitive. Examples include New York City, Garden City, New York, Los Angeles, Lower East Side, and AKAs like The Big Apple. When a single locality is supplied, the response JSON includes query.locality.signal with the matched Qloo entity. If multiple are supplied, this field is omitted. By default, the API includes a tuning that also captures nearby entities just outside the official boundaries of the locality. To turn this off and limit results strictly to within the locality, set filter.location.radius=0. If no localities are found, the API returns a 400 error.

Destination, Place

filter.location.geohash

string

Filter by a geohash. Geohashes are generated using the Python package pygeohash with a precision of 12 characters. This parameter returns all POIs that start with the specified geohash. For example, supplying dr5rs would allow returning the geohash dr5rsjk4sr2w.

Destination, Place

filter.exclude.location.geohash

string

Exclude all entities whose geohash starts with the specified prefix.
Geohashes are generated using the Python package pygeohash with a precision of 12 characters.
For example, supplying dr5rs would exclude any result whose geohash begins with dr5rs, such as dr5rsjk4sr2w.

Destination, Place

filter.location.radius

integer

Filter by the radius (in meters) when also supplying filter.location or filter.location.query.
When this parameter is not provided, the API applies a default tuning that slightly expands the locality boundary to include nearby entities outside its official shape.
To disable this behavior and strictly limit results to entities inside the defined locality boundary, set filter.location.radius=0.

Destination, Place
